AI Summary
-
Increases the Hawaii children's trust fund advisory board from seven to fifteen members, adding representatives from the family health services division, department of human services, office of youth services, superintendent of education, chief justice of the judiciary, and executive office on early learning.
-
Expands the advisory board's responsibilities to include establishing grantmaking criteria and guidelines, advising the department of health, developing statewide prevention strategies, identifying system problem areas, and collaborating on policy development.
-
Allows four members of the advisory board to be selected by the Hawaii children's trust fund coalition to represent each county and the city and county of Honolulu, plus one member to represent survivors of child abuse and neglect.
-
Redefines the Hawaii children's trust fund coalition's role to focus on maintaining communication networks, encouraging interagency collaboration, identifying resource leverage opportunities, and informing the advisory board of prevention needs.
-
Repeals the Hawaii children's trust fund advisory committee, consolidating its functions into the expanded advisory board and coalition structure.
